Should You Start or Sit DeMario Douglas in Week 7?
DeMario Douglas entered Week 6 averaging under 10 yards per catch, but because this is Drake Maye’s world and we are all just living in it, he was on the right side of a 53-yard touchdown (40 air yards).
The highlight was fun (12.3-point play for a player who had 16.4 points through five weeks), but that’s all it was. Outside of the splash play, he caught just two passes against the Saints and still has just 10 catches on his resume this season.
If I’m trying to get exposure to this offense, it’s by way of a player that I believe carries more scoring equity like Hunter Henry or Kayshon Boutte.

Douglas’ Fantasy Points Projection in Week 7
Douglas is projected to score 8.0 fantasy points in PPR formats.
We project Douglas to have 4 receptions for 37 yards and 0.1 touchdowns. Douglas could also add 2 rushing yards.
